I really doubt this is an issue of low quality audio, sound signature, poor product, etc... The most glaring thing you stated was the onboard audio of your laptop. It is absolutely terrible. I don't even think it could power skull candy (brutally honest here). Yes, you would notice an improvement with your iPod. You would notice a massive improvement with a good dac/amp combo. M50 is wonderful, but only if you treat them well. Feed them garbage and they will spit it back out at you.

 

For example, I purchased the xonar essence stx for my desktop to power my DT770. Now if I plug my headphones into my iPhone, I can't even listen to an entire song before ripping the headphones off. Source makes such a huge difference. I actually had to buy a different pair of cans for portable use and my DT770 never leaves my desktop.

203s are fun cans but extremely dark where it sounds like the percussion is in the backyard. You can hear the extension but just not as prominent as the bass side of things. The M50s should be like 3xs brighter. As people have mentioned the M50s need like several hours like over 100 to settle. They still won't have bass comparable to the 203s. But everything else will sound in better balance. The M50s still one of my favorite cans as they are more than capable and versatile with dynamics and resolution. I always hear so many people not liking their sound card. Try borrowing a friend iPod or player and see if you get any improvement.
